<p>You are given two strings <code>s</code> and <code>target</code>, each of length <code>n</code>, consisting of lowercase English letters.</p>
<p>Return the <strong><span data-keyword="lexicographically-smaller-string">lexicographically smallest</span> string</strong> that is <strong>both</strong> a <strong><span data-keyword="palindrome-string">palindromic</span> <span data-keyword="permutation">permutation</span></strong> of <code>s</code> and <strong>strictly</strong> greater than <code>target</code>. If no such permutation exists, return an empty string.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><strong class="example">Example 1:</strong></p>
<div class="example-block">
<p><strong>Input:</strong> <span class="example-io">s = &quot;baba&quot;, target = &quot;abba&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Output:</strong> <span class="example-io">&quot;baab&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Explanation: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>The palindromic permutations of <code>s</code> (in lexicographical order) are <code>&quot;abba&quot;</code> and <code>&quot;baab&quot;</code>.</li>
<li>The lexicographically smallest permutation that is strictly greater than <code>target</code> is <code>&quot;baab&quot;</code>.</li>
</ul>
</div>
<p><strong class="example">Example 2:</strong></p>
<div class="example-block">
<p><strong>Input:</strong> <span class="example-io">s = &quot;baba&quot;, target = &quot;bbaa&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Output:</strong> <span class="example-io">&quot;&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Explanation: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>The palindromic permutations of <code>s</code> (in lexicographical order) are <code>&quot;abba&quot;</code> and <code>&quot;baab&quot;</code>.</li>
<li>None of them is lexicographically strictly greater than <code>target</code>. Therefore, the answer is <code>&quot;&quot;</code>.</li>
</ul>
</div>
<p><strong class="example">Example 3:</strong></p>
<div class="example-block">
<p><strong>Input:</strong> <span class="example-io">s = &quot;abc&quot;, target = &quot;abb&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Output:</strong> <span class="example-io">&quot;&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Explanation:</strong></p>
<p><code>s</code> has no palindromic permutations. Therefore, the answer is <code>&quot;&quot;</code>.</p>
</div>
<p><strong class="example">Example 4:</strong></p>
<div class="example-block">
<p><strong>Input:</strong> <span class="example-io">s = &quot;aac&quot;, target = &quot;abb&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Output:</strong> <span class="example-io">&quot;aca&quot;</span></p>
<p><strong>Explanation: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>The only palindromic permutation of <code>s</code> is <code>&quot;aca&quot;</code>.</li>
<li><code>&quot;aca&quot;</code> is strictly greater than <code>target</code>. Therefore, the answer is <code>&quot;aca&quot;</code>.</li>
</ul>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><strong>Constraints: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><code>1 &lt;= n == s.length == target.length &lt;= 300</code></li>
<li><code>s</code> and <code>target</code> consist of only lowercase English letters.</li>
</ul>
